Who is Saul Rappaport?
Saul Rappaport is a professor emeritus of physics at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ology. Rappaport became Assistant Professor in the MIT Department of Physics in 1969 and became a full Professor in 1981. From 1993 to 1995, he was Head of the Astrophysics Division.
He received his A.B. from Temple University in 1963 and his Ph.D. from MIT in 1968.
His main research interest is in binary systems containing collapsed stars—white dwarfs, neutron stars, pulsars, and black holes.
